West Los Angeles offers the quintessential Westside lifestyle—an ideal blend of convenience, connectivity, and neighborhood charm. Perfectly situated between Santa Monica, Century City, and Westwood, this highly desirable community places residents at the center of some of Los Angeles' most sought-after destinations while maintaining a welcoming residential feel.

Known for its tree-lined streets and diverse housing options, West LA continues to attract buyers seeking an unbeatable location with easy access to the very best of the Westside. Residents enjoy proximity to highly regarded Westwood Charter Elementary School, as well as premier shopping, dining, and entertainment at nearby Westfield Century City, home to luxury retailers, Eataly, Gelson's, and an AMC movie theater.

The neighborhood offers abundant recreation opportunities with both Westwood Park and Cheviot Hills Recreation Center nearby, while fitness enthusiasts enjoy convenient access to Equinox and Beyond Fitness LA. Popular restaurants along Westwood Boulevard, everyday conveniences including Sprouts Farmers Market, and the iconic Fox Studio Lot further enhance the area's appeal.

Approximately 15 minutes from Santa Monica's beaches, West Los Angeles combines exceptional convenience, strong neighborhood character, and a central location that continues to make it one of the Westside's most desirable places to call home.


Overview for West Los Angeles, CA

64,252 people live in West Los Angeles, where the median age is 38 and the average individual income is $80,372. Data provided by the U.S. Census Bureau.
